About the role

  • Agilist role at U.S. Bank focusing on Agile practices for product teams. Driving discovery, product strategy, and Agile methodologies to ensure successful outcomes.

Responsibilities

  • Drive delivery by enabling the product/team to consistently conduct discovery focused on the customer, experiment and evolve product strategy based on prior outcomes and feedback loops.
  • Operate in a one-to-many ratio of Agilist to teams, with a focus on thoughtful and impactful use of your time to support the teams and leaders.
  • Own the Agile practices of the team/product group/journey including coaching and guidance on events, cross-portfolio impacts, planning, dependency maps, OKRs (Objectives and Key Results) and key metrics for success in partnership with Product Management, business partners, digital and technology modelling agile methods, values, and principles.
  • Champion and coach on Agile ways of working and mindset.
  • Focuses on Agile methods for prioritization, supports product management routines such as QPP, scaling the Shield Way of Working Toolkit, and builds the expertise of the team through coaching and training.
  • Implement and lead tactics using Agile tools for product roadmaps, OKRs, sprint planning, backlog refinement and collaboration (tools include JIRA, Confluence, Dragonboat, Mural, KYT metrics).
  • Refine Definition of Done, MVP (coaching), Personas, and Story Maps and supports coaching on refinement tactics of the backlog.
  • Assist with funding, staffing and team rosters including overseeing team kickoff training and vendor management.
  • Establish and monitor team/Agile metrics to improve the discovery and delivery of the team related to customer outcomes and continuous improvement.
  • Identify and close communication gaps that impact alignment, delivery, or adoption.
  • Translate complex initiatives into clear, digestible messaging for teams and stakeholders
